- Check
all seams and fabric before each use to be sure they are in good
condition. If there are areas that look worn or frayed, do not use
the sling. For warranty or repair work contact info@idajdesigns.com
- Use
common sense when using your sling.
-
Do not use with children over 35 lbs.
-
Be careful going through doorways and around corners and when you
are near anything sharp or hot (no cooking with baby in the sling).
- Do
not wear your baby in the sling while traveling in a car, bike or
airplane.
-
Do not put anything but your baby in the sling. Use the pocket!
-
Always be aware of the rings as you take the baby in and out of
the carrier.
- Until
you are comfortable using your sling, keep one hand on your baby.
- Don’t
leave you baby unattended in the sling.
- If
you need to pick something up, be sure to squat rather than bend
over (baby can fall out if you bend over).
